Property restituted to the Heirs of Jacques Goudstikker


Salomon van Ruysdael

Naarden circa 1602 - 1670 Haarlem

A view on the river Vecht with Kasteel Nijenrode beyond


signed lower left on the ferry: SVRuysdael (SVR in ligature)

oil on oak panel

72 x 88.5 cm.; 28⅜ x 34⅞ in.

With Charles Sedelmeyer, Vienna, 1872;

By whom sold, Vienna, 20 December 1872, lot 145, for 2,600 Florins;

Geheimrat Dr. E. Hölscher, Mülheim am Rhein, by 1916;

His sale, Berlin, Lepke, 5 December 1916, lot 34, for 20,000 Reichsmark;

Michiel Onnes van Nijenrode, Castle Nijenrode;

His sale, Amsterdam, Frederik Muller, 4 July 1933, lot 29, for 4,600 Guilders to Goudstikker;

With Jacques Goudstikker, Amsterdam (his label on the reverse of the panel);

Looted by the Nazis in Amsterdam, July 1940;

Hermann Göring, Carinhall and Berchtesgaden (RM-Number 342);

Transferred by the Allied Fores from Berchtesgaden to the Central Collecting Point, Munich, 27 July 1945 (Mü-Number 5415);

Repatriated to The Netherlands on 20 October 1945;

Where transferred to the Stichting Nederlands Kunstbezit (SNK);

Mossel sale, Amsterdam, Frederik Muller, 11 March 1952, lot 747 (consigned by the above, Archief SNK 2.08.42, inv. nr. 876);

Anonymous sale (‘The Property of a Gentleman’), London, Christie’s, 1 April 1960, lot 74, for 15,000 guineas to Speelman;

With Edward Speelman, London;

Jocelyn Stevens, Esq.,

By whom sold, London, Christie’s, 2 July 1976, lot 73;

With Richard Green, London, October 1976;

Anonymous sale, Vienna, Dorotheum, 13–19 November 1979;

Anonymous sale, Dorotheum, Vienna, 16 November 1983, withdrawn by the Exekutionsgericht, Vienna;

Anonymous sale, Vienna, Dorotheum, 11 December 1985, where presumably acquired by the father of the previous owners;

Thence by descent;

Restituted to the heir of Jacques Goudstikker, November 2022.
